
Bruce Springsteen Adds New Dates To Australian 2014 Tour
It looks like Australia and New Zealand can’t get enough of Bruce Springsteen and the E Street Band, who have announced three new dates to their 2014 tour across Australasia due to high demand.
They brought the Wrecking Ball tour to Australia earlier this year, where Springsteen’s manager and producer, Jon Landau, said that “the crowds were tremendous, the fans as warm, friendly, and welcoming as we could ever hope for”. So it’s no surprise they’re going back for more so soon.
The recently added dates, which will take place in Perth, Adelaide and Hunter Valley, take the total number of shows up to thirteen. Unlucky for some, but it’s not looking that way for Springsteen and co, who already have a number of shows sold out.
The 2014 tour starts on February 7th, lasting for just under a month, and marks their first ever visit to Perth and Adelaide. Bruce and his main backing band will also stop for two stadium shows in Melbourne as well as dates in other major cities Sydney, Brisbane and Auckland. Not a bad trip all round.
Pre-sale tickets will be available on September 23rd 2013, and will go on general sale on September 26th 2013. The group have previously collaborated with stars like Bob Dylan, Lady Gaga, David Bowie and Ray Davies to namedrop just a few, and music legends of the southern hemisphere, Hunters & Collectors, have already been announced to reform as special guests at the Melbourne AAMI Stadium date.
